Is 16 Gauge Wire Adequate for Trailer Wiring for Lighting
Question:
I am re-wiring the running lights 2/brake lights/lic plate lights on a 13 foot vintage camper. It had a 4 prong on it. Will a 16 gauge 4 prong be an adequate replacement for this system. No trailer brakes.
asked by: Dave S
Expert Reply:
Most trailer wiring that runs to trailer lights is 16 gauge. I would rather people use 14 or 12 unless the lights are LED which draw considerably less. But for most people 16 gauge works just fine for basic trailer lighting. If you are planning on running several running lights or just more lights in general you would want thicker wire.
